Citibank History in Short
Citibank is the primary banking subsidiary of the US-based multinational corporation Citigroup. It was founded in 1812 as the City Bank of New York and later became the First National City Bank of New York. The company has official branches in 19 countries and operates across 94 markets.
The first president of City Bank was Samuel Osgood. Throughout its history, the company has undergone numerous changes and leadership transitions. One of the key milestones was in 1865 when the bank joined the United States National Banking System under the National Bank Act and became The National City Bank of New York. Notably, after 1893, the bank emerged as one of the largest in the United States.
In 1914, National City Bank became the first US bank to open a foreign branch, established in Buenos Aires, Argentina. By 1919, it also became the first US financial institution to reach $1 billion in assets.
Here are several key events that shaped Citibank’s operations and financial history:
- 1960s. The bank entered the credit card business, launching The Everything Card.
- 1980s. Citibank introduced Citicard, which allowed customers to make transactions without a passbook and use ATMs. In 1984, John S. Reed became the bank’s CEO and expanded the company’s presence to 90 markets.
- 2000s-2010s. These years marked rapid growth for the bank, including rebranding its cards under the name Department Stores National Bank. Plus, the financial company acquired Best Buy’s credit card portfolio from Capital One and became the exclusive issuer of Costco’s branded credit cards.
Although Citibank exited several markets in 2021, including Russia, Vietnam, Bahrain, China, Indonesia, and South Korea, among others, the company remains one of the most successful in the financial world.

Account Types
The Most Popular Account Types
Based on our clients’ preferences, these are the most popular bank account types:
- Citibank basic checking account. This is the most basic account option, brilliant for clients with no initial savings but who can maintain a combined average monthly balance of $1,500 across linked accounts. It allows customers to write paper checks and access mobile banking, Zelle transfers, bill payments, and more. Clients also may receive a debit card for everyday use.
- Citi Priority. This account type allows you to grow your savings with competitive interest rates – up to 7.51% p.a. Clients also get access to financial advisors and global support from dedicated managers. You must maintain a balance of over $30,000 to open this account.
- Citigold checking account. This option is ideal for clients with a minimum combined balance of $200,000. It offersfee-free financial transactions, preferred rates on investment and lending products, and access to a dedicated advisor for personalized financial guidance.

How to Open a Citibank Account?
The main requirement for opening an account at Citibank is that you should be at least 18 years old. Plus, there’s a list of required documents to gather. We have created a detailed table with comprehensive information about Citibank’s account opening requirements for both US residents and non-residents.
| Type of document | US residents | Non-residents |
| Identification | Passport or driver’s license | Foreign passport |
| SSN/ITIN | Social Security Number | Individual Taxpayer Identification Number (ITIN |
| Address proving | Bank statement or recent utility bill | Proof of address in home country |
| Supplemental documents | Income verification | Valid US visa |
After preparing all the necessary documents, you can proceed with opening an account with Citibank.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to go through this procedure online:
- Visit the official Citibank website and find the “Open an Account” section.
- You will be presented with several accounts – pick the one that suits you best.
- Please proceed to fill out the online application form by entering the required details as specified by the bank. Carefully check that all the information is correct to avoid any errors.
- Upload photos of your documents to the website. Specifically, you must upload a government-issued photo ID and a utility bill showing your current address. If you are a USA resident, you should also provide your Social Security details for tax verification.
After this, you will need to wait for the bank to approve your application and activate your account. Once approved, Citibank will send you your account details, which you can use.
If you have a local Citibank branch in your country, you may also open an account personally. Below are the main steps you’ll need to follow:
- Open the bank’s branch locator to find the nearest location and plan your visit.
- Speak with a bank representative who will assist you in filling out the account opening application.
- Submit your documents for verification (the list of documents is the same as for online applications).
- Wait for your application to be approved. Once this happens, the bank representatives will contact you, provide your account details, and activate the account.
